Yes, alcohol can be delivered in Illinois. However, there are some restrictions that must be followed when ordering and delivering alcoholic beverages.
In general, only licensed retailers and distributors may deliver alcohol in the state of Illinois. Furthermore, these individuals must follow specific guidelines set by the state to ensure that all rules and regulations are met.
Below are some of the most important rules and regulations for alcohol delivery in Illinois:
- Only retailers with a valid license may deliver alcohol.
- The recipient must be 21 years of age or older.
- Alcoholic beverages must be purchased from a licensed retailer/distributor.
- Delivery personnel must check the identification of the recipient prior to delivery.
Yes, alcohol delivery is legal in Illinois. The state has allowed third-party delivery of beer, wine and spirits since 2018. However, the delivery of alcohol must be done through a licensed retailer. Also, the delivery person must be at least 21 years old and must present valid identification when delivering the order.
The person who orders the alcohol must also be at least 21 years old and provide valid identification when receiving the order. The package must be sealed and labeled with the name of the retailer from which it was purchased. In addition, retailers are only allowed to deliver alcoholic beverages between 8 a.m. and 11 p.m., seven days a week.

Age Requirements for Alcohol Delivery in Illinois
In Illinois, the legal drinking age is 21 years old. Anyone under this age cannot purchase, possess, or consume alcohol. As such, anyone who orders or receives alcohol delivery in Illinois must be at least 21 years of age. All companies that offer alcohol delivery must confirm the age of the person ordering the alcohol before completing the delivery.
To ensure compliance with state law, many companies require customers to provide proof of age when ordering alcohol delivery. This can include a valid government-issued ID card or a driver’s license that shows the customer’s date of birth and current address. Once the customer has provided proof of their age, the company is allowed to proceed with delivering their order.
It is important to note that companies offering alcohol delivery are responsible for verifying the age of their customers and ensuring they do not deliver to anyone who is underage. If they are found to have delivered to someone under 21 years old, they can face stiff penalties from state authorities and could even have their business license revoked.
